Re: probably a really stupid question
Your black AIR box comes off, the rubber hoses that connect to the black box/the one way valves connected to the metal tubes, the metal air tubes that connect to each separate pipe on the exhaust manifold, the air management tube that connects to the catalytic converter (you will need a new cat otherwise you'll have a hole in your cat where the tube used to go), and finally the smog pump.
You will need to either get a delete box for the smog pump or route a smaller belt around it.
It would be better to get a pair of Hooker 2055's
http://www.jegs.com/i/Hooker/520/2055/10002/-1
and just leave the air equipment intact. These bolt up directly.
